Real‑World Playbook: How to Navigate the Skrill Minefield

First, set expectations straight. Treat every withdrawal as a math problem, not a lucky break. Here’s a quick rundown of the steps that actually matter:

  • Verify your Skrill account twice—once for KYC, once for “security” that could have been a checkbox.
  • Check the casino’s withdrawal window. Jackpot City, for instance, processes payouts within 48 hours, but it still bows to Skrill’s batch schedule.
  • Plan for the conversion rate. Canadian dollars to euros (Skrill’s home turf) sneaks in a spread that erodes your win before it hits your wallet.
